Russia's natural gas output in the first five months of 2009 fell 19.2% year-on-year to 238 billion cubic meters, the RIA Novosti news agency reports Monday citing national statistics service Rosstat.

The agency also reports Russia's natural gas exports to countries other than former Soviet republics fell 50% year-on-year in January-May to 37.8 bcm, citing the Federal Customs Service.

Exports to the Commonwealth of Independent States, a loose association of former Soviet republics excluding the Baltic States, fell 41.2% to 5.3 bcm, according to the report.

Overall, Russia exported 43.1 bcm, worth $12.9 billion, in the first five months of the year, the Federal Customs Service said.
